OUSD (R&E) CRITICAL TECHNOLOGY AREA(S): Advanced Computing and Software; Integrated Sensing and Cyber; Directed Energy (DE); Integrated Network System-of-Systems; Space Technology The technology within this topic is restricted under the International Traffic in Arms Regulation (ITAR), 22 CFR Parts 120-130, which controls the export and import of defense-related material and services, including export of sensitive technical data, or the Export Administration Regulation (EAR), 15 CFR Parts 730-774, which controls dual use items. Offerors must disclose any proposed use of foreign nationals (FNs), their country(ies) of origin, the type of visa or work permit possessed, and the statement of work (SOW) tasks intended for accomplishment by the FN(s) in accordance with the Announcement. Offerors are advised foreign nationals proposed to perform on this topic may be restricted due to the technical data under US Export Control Laws. OBJECTIVE: To optimize telescope mount and sensor usage for contributing Space Domain Awareness (SDA) operations, R&D, mission partner campaigns, maintenance, upgrades and associated personnel. Develop a DevOps path to production for capabilities that support Squadron business functions. Develop a DevOps path to production for mission capabilities to include Development/Test/Production environments for GEODSS and R&D Operations. Build and deliver a 15 SPSS Portal - marketing/advertising, scheduling, statusing, optimization, assessment, metrics/dashboard, SITREPs/MISREPs. DESCRIPTION: Host a kickoff meeting with the Government led Product Team, dev team, engineer team and associated stakeholders. Conduct a discovery and findings to address technical and programmatic needs including; re-use of existing tools/code, evaluation of potential platforms and opportunities to deliver new capabilities to the 15 SPSS. PHASE I: As this is a Direct-to-Phase-II (D2P2) topic, no Phase I awards will be made as a result of this topic. To qualify for this D2P2 topic, the Government expects the Offeror to demonstrate feasibility by means of a prior Phase I-type effort that does not constitute work undertaken as part of a prior SBIR/STTR funding agreement. In order to demonstrate the feasibility that would have otherwise been demonstrated during Phase I performance, the Government expects Offerors to demonstrate a technical solution for an initial software deployment of an app that tracks telescope mount usesage requests, scheduled downtime due to maintenance, sensor usage, and human resources required for all of the above. PHASE II: Develop a Path to Production for space sensor resource scheduling prototype. Prototype shall be required to deploy in both laboratory and operational environments. PHASE III DUAL USE APPLICATIONS: Phase III will continue to provide the same criterium as Phase II but will include more site infrastructure software modernization. Phase I: Establish the technical merit, feasibility, and commercial potential of the proposed R/R&D efforts and determine the quality of performance of the small business awardee organization.
Phase II: Continue the R/R&D efforts initiated in Phase I. Funding is based on the results achieved in Phase I and the scientific and technical merit and commercial potential of the project proposed in Phase II. Typically, only Phase I awardees are eligible for a Phase II award
